"Dabadabadá" is a song by Spanish singer Melody. This was a single from her third album T.Q.M.. She released it in 2003, at the age of 12.[1]

The song debuted at number 9 in Spain for the week of 14 September 2003.[2]
The song was part of the Spanish soundtrack to the Brazilian soap opera Mulheres Apaixonadas (Mujeres apasionadas in Spain), appearing on the soundtrack album released in 2004.[3] It's one of the songs Melody is remembered for.[4]
Melody performed the song on several television shows in order to promote it with the most notable one being on the show Música Sí.[5]
